Output 3db77fc31f012de4398a40b992c0be463c104b12c98b58e42eeaafaafd1764f6:4

value
245627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3ca080a7751571a3409f574d84b866985fcbef OP_EQUAL
address
3G2Qe6YTdPExAyywsng6cfAAfp16Yg87tt
transaction
3db77fc31f012de4398a40b992c0be463c104b12c98b58e42eeaafaafd1764f6
spent
true